Okay, there's some info that does potential help.
1. Vern Olsen would only be able to wear that style uniform in 1942. 2. On July 8, 1942, the Chicago Cubs purchased Warneke. Meaning at least this photo of Lou Warneke was taken sometime after 7/8/1942. IF the set of photos were all taken from the same game in 1942 (Olsen, Warneke & Hopp) that narrows the time frame window. Cardinals vs. Cubs at Wrigley Field August 11-13th 1942 or September 20th 1942 double header. Just one possibility. |
